Maybe it's my medical background, but there were several obvious (to me, at least) errors in this episode, so I thought I'd list them here:

1. Police scanner states "suspect vehicle description two-door domestic, dark blue" when the car actually used is 4-door and light-colored (beige?).

2. When DM disconnects himself from the ER monitors, the ECG machine continues to show a steady heartbeat in the background - it should flatline when he removes the leads.

3. Skull radiographs will show a skull fracture, but not soft tissue injuries like edema or hemorrhage. You need something like an MRI for that.

4. When Barbara is telling Randi that DM was discharged, you can see her nametag says "Madison Jun".

5. I challenge anyone, using any computer program they want, to take a blur and "sharpen" it into a useful image. This defies the laws of . . . pixelation.
